Kerala, located on the southwestern Malabar Coast of India, is revered for its diverse landscapes and rich cultural heritage. Historically a center for spice trade, the region has attracted traders from around the world, shaping its unique cultural tapestry. From its lush hillsides in Munnar to the calm backwaters of Alleppey, this trip offers a perfect blend of natural beauty, cultural encounters, and gastronomic experiences that make Kerala a top travel destination for visitors around the globe.

### Top Attractions: Must-Visit Places in Kerala 🌟

As you embark on this 5-day journey, here are the must-visit places that capture the essence of Kerala:

1. **Munnar’s Scenic Beauty 🌿**
Nestled in the Western Ghats, Munnar is famed for its rolling hills blanketed with tea plantations. The crisp mountain air and panoramic views offer a serene escape. Don’t miss the Eravikulam National Park, home to the endangered Nilgiri Tahr.

2. **Thekkady’s Wildlife & Spice Tour 🐅**
Thekkady, located near the Periyar National Park, offers travelers a chance to spot elephants, tigers, and various bird species. The spice plantations provide a fragrant backdrop, making it a haven for nature and spice lovers alike.

3. **Alleppey’s Backwater Serenity 🚤**
Often referred to as the “Venice of the East,” Alleppey’s network of serene backwaters can be experienced aboard a luxurious houseboat. Spend the day cruising through the tranquil waters, absorbing the lush green surroundings.

4. **Cultural Experience in Kochi 🕌**
Kochi is a melting pot of cultures, with its vibrant history reflected in its colonial-era buildings, old churches, and traditional Kathakali performances. Explore the Jew Town, the Dutch Palace, and the iconic Chinese fishing nets at Fort Kochi.

5. **Eravikulam National Park Adventure 🌿**
Home to diverse flora and fauna, Eravikulam National Park, located near Munnar, beckons adventure enthusiasts with its exhilarating trekking trails and opportunity to spot the unique Nilgiri Tahr.

### Local Cuisine: Savor the Flavors of Kerala 🍲

Kerala’s cuisine is a delightful blend of spicy and aromatic flavors, often centered around seafood, coconut, and rice. Signature dishes include:

– **Appam with Stew**: This lacy pancake paired with a creamy coconut milk-based stew is a breakfast staple.
– **Karimeen Pollichathu**: A local fish delicacy, marinated with spices and wrapped in banana leaves.
– **Puttu and Kadala Curry**: A popular breakfast combination made with steamed rice cakes and a chickpea curry.
– **Sadhya**: A traditional vegetarian feast served on a banana leaf, typically enjoyed during festivals.

Don’t forget to try the local filter coffee and the internationally famous Kerala sadhya, offering a taste of this region’s culinary hospitality.

### Best Time to Visit: Optimal Seasons for Your Kerala Journey ☀️🌧️

To fully experience the beauty and activities Kerala offers, the best time to visit is from **October to March**. During these months, the weather is comfortable, making it ideal for sightseeing. The monsoon season, from **June to September**, though wet, turns the landscape lush and green, offering a different charm. However, if you’re interested in Ayurveda treatments and enjoying indoor relaxation, this might be a great time to visit.

### Travel Tips: Navigate Your Journey with Ease 🧳

– **Packing Essentials**: Lightweight clothing, sunscreen, and a raincoat (during monsoon) are must-haves. Don’t forget your camera to capture the breathtaking sceneries.
– **Transportation**: The trip includes all transfers and sightseeing in an AC vehicle. For local exploration, auto-rickshaws and local cabs are available.
– **Cultural Etiquette**: Respect local customs by dressing modestly, especially when visiting temples. Always remove your shoes before entering.
– **Local Currency**: It’s advisable to carry some cash (INR) for small purchases, though cards are widely accepted in most tourist spots.
– **Do’s and Don’ts**: Do participate in local festivals if the opportunity arises, but don’t litter, especially in sensitive areas like national parks.
